Full Mouth Rehabilitation

Full mouth rehabilitation, also known as full mouth reconstruction or full mouth restoration, is a comprehensive dental treatment that aims to restore the health, function, and aesthetics of the entire mouth.

It involves addressing multiple dental issues simultaneously, including missing teeth, tooth decay, gum disease, bite problems, and damaged or worn-out teeth. This extensive process requires careful planning, coordination, and collaboration between the patient and a team of dental specialists.

The need for full mouth rehabilitation often arises in individuals with severe dental problems resulting from factors such as trauma, extensive decay, congenital disorders, or long-term neglect of oral hygiene. These issues can significantly impact a person’s ability to eat, speak, and smile comfortably, as well as their overall quality of life. Full mouth rehabilitation offers a comprehensive solution to restore oral health, function, and aesthetics, thereby improving the patient’s confidence and well-being.
